On 22/01/2009, Edward_Herrera <[email protected]> wrote: > > Hi, I want to perform a Log replay as is. The scenario is as follows > > User1: login.jsp .........................(1) > User1: show_books.jsp > User2: login.jsp ..........................(2) > User1: buy_book.jsp > User2: myAccount.jsp > User1: logout.jsp > User2: logout.jsp > > How can I do for preserving the execution order without losing the SessionID > for each User? > I try using a CookieManager but this works for all the HTTPRequest, The > CookieManager doesn't distinguish the login.jsp (1) from the login.jsp (2). > If I put each User in one separate thread then the concurrent execution > could change the execution order that I want to preserve.
I assume that you are using the Access Log sampler? I'm afraid that does not (yet) have support for multiple users.
